In 1887, Alfred Alden Robbins entered the world in Saint Peters Bay, Kings, Prince Edward Island, Canada, born to William Robbins And Mary Ann Betts. In 1901, Alfred Alden Robbins resided in Prince Edward Island, Canada. Alfred Alden Robbins married Winnifred Jessie Acorn, and had children including Alden Acorn Robbins, Doris Mae Robbins. Alfred Alden Robbins passed away in 1986 in Lexington, Middlesex, Massachusetts, USA.
